The Pettersson Trade

The Vancouver Canucks have traded Marcus Pettersson, a 30-year-old defenseman, to the Rangers in exchange for a conditional first-round pick in the 2030 NHL Draft. Pettersson, who has five years remaining on a lucrative contract, brings a wealth of experience and a solid offensive presence to the Rangers' blue line. His 18 points last season, including three goals, showcase his ability to contribute offensively.

What makes this trade particularly fascinating is the conditional nature of the draft pick. If the Rangers' pick falls within the top 10 in 2030, it will be pushed back to the 2031 draft, an interesting strategy to consider.
